Recent Developments in the Market:
? In March 2022, Toshiba Electronic Devices & Storage Corporation introduced the TPH9R00CQH, a 150V N-channel power MOSFET. It employs the most recent generation process, U-MOSX-H, which is suitable for use in switching power supplies for industrial equipment, such as those used in communications base stations and data centres.
? In March 2021, Alpha and Omega Semiconductor announced the availability of new AEC-Q101 qualified 1200V silicon carbide (SiC) MOSFETs. This is ideal for electric vehicle (EV) on-board chargers, motor drive inverters, and off-board charging stations that require high efficiency and reliability.
